In March 2024 I noticed a dark mole on my lower right calf, it was raised and became very itchy. When my GP saw it, he referred me to Dermatology. I had a biopsy taken on 2nd May and 4 weeks later on the 30th May I was back for the results. It was stage 1b malignant melanoma (skin cancer) and I would need further surgery to remove a bigger margin. I had the surgery on the 25th June and two weeks later my results came back all clear. Fantastic News !!!
The support I had from Action Cancer has been amazing, helping me to deal with the emotional and mental side of the diagnosis.

For that last 50 years, Action Cancer, Northern Irelands leading, local cancer charity was founded in 1973 by Dr George Edelstyn and since then it has continued to grow and evolve as the demand for its cancer prevention, detection and support services has increased over the last five decades.
Our mission is to save lives and support local people at risk or impacted by a cancer diagnosis and the services that Action Cancer provide to do this are free to the user but come at a cost to the charity of £4 million every year. These services include an early detection breast screening clinic, early detection skin cancer screening clinic, therapeutic services for people living with a cancer diagnosis as well as people supporting a loved one with a diagnosis and a range of health improvement services.
